Great to see your interest! Uruguay has a rich culinary tradition that includes various delicious dishes. Here are a few that might resonate well with the LA food scene:
- Asado: This traditional barbecue is a staple in Uruguay and can be a great way to bring people together, much like how grilling is popular in many cultures.
- Empanadas: These savory pastries filled with meat or cheese are perfect finger foods that can appeal to many different palates.
- Chivito: A hearty sandwich that includes steak, cheese, and various toppings, it embodies the essence of Uruguayan comfort food.

Absolutely, there are several documentaries and shows that focus on food sustainability and cultural appreciation. A few recommendations include:
- Chef's Table: This series features chefs from around the world, including those who emphasize sustainability in their cooking.
- Jiro Dreams of Sushi: This documentary not only dives into sushi but also into the philosophy of sourcing ingredients responsibly.
- Street Food: This series showcases street food vendors across various countries and often highlights local traditions and sourcing practices.
